because the sentra has a 67-33 weight ratio front to back and it handles like a frozen turd compared to if you relocate some of the weight to the back, like a lightweight hood and battery relocation. In drag racing is the only time you want a bunch of weight over your front tires and a more balanced car = faster lap times, turns > straight
